Our Terms of Service and Privacy Policy have changed.

By continuing to use this site, you are agreeing to the new Privacy Policy and Terms of Service.

Ambarella Inc (NASDAQ:AMBA)

51.64
Delayed Data
As of Jan 13
 +0.83 / +1.63%
Today’s Change
33.39
Today|||52-Week Range
74.95
-4.60%
Year-to-Date
Institutional ownership of AMBA stands at $296.6 thousand shares or 60.25% of shares outstanding. This is in-line with the Semiconductors industry average.
Other institutional40.00%
Mutual fund holders20.25%
Individual stakeholders13.92%

Largest Quarterly Institutional
Transactions

Latest Institutional Activity

12/31/2016INDEPENDENT PORTFOLIO CONSULTANT...  Bought 7.5 Thousand shares of Ambarella Inc
1/05/2017GO ETF SOLUTIONS LLP  Bought 1.3 Thousand shares of Ambarella Inc
12/30/2016CREDIT SUISSE AG  Bought 1.1 Thousand shares of Ambarella Inc

Top 10 Owners of Ambarella Inc

StockholderStakeShares
owned
Total value ($)Shares
bought / sold
Total
change
The Vanguard Group, Inc.5.83%1,930,899104,519,563+55,919+2.98%
BlackRock Fund Advisors3.42%1,131,65461,256,431+67,952+6.39%
Blue Ridge Capital LLC (New York)3.01%998,00054,021,74000.00%
D. E. Shaw & Co. LP2.90%961,11152,024,938+582,296+153.72%
Delaware Management Business Trus...2.48%821,48744,467,091+734,097+840.02%
Coatue Management LLC2.44%806,53743,657,848-228,621-22.09%
Van Berkom & Associates, Inc.1.80%595,31732,224,509-114,830-16.17%
Fidelity Management & Research Co...1.75%579,26931,355,831-32,267-5.28%
Tide Point Capital Management LP1.66%550,00029,771,500+150,000+37.50%
Pinnacle Associates Ltd.1.56%516,28427,946,453-7,645-1.46%

Top 10 Mutual Funds Holding Ambarella Inc

Mutual fundStakeShares
owned
Total value ($)Shares
bought / sold
Total
change
Vanguard Small Cap Index Fund2.09%691,25337,417,525+11,724+1.73%
iShares Russell 2000 ETF1.98%657,08235,567,849+6,122+0.94%
Vanguard Total Stock Market Index...1.98%655,70935,493,528+7,622+1.18%
Vanguard Small Cap Growth Index F...1.18%389,75721,097,546+6,196+1.62%
Lord Abbett Developing Growth Fun...0.89%294,29615,930,242+33,076+12.66%
Fidelity Information Technology C...0.68%223,50012,098,055-18,900-7.80%
TIAA-CREF Growth & Income Fund0.57%189,25410,244,319+35,260+22.90%
CREF Stock Account0.57%188,22610,188,673+17,604+10.32%
iShares Russell 2000 Value ETF0.51%167,7709,081,390+345+0.21%
Fidelity Select Technology Portfo...0.51%167,3009,055,94900.00%